Gallery: Lansdale Historical Society Event Married Tradition With Tea

The second annual Spring Tea fundraiser at Elm Terrace featured a look back on eight decades of wedding traditions

 

Here came the brides, all dressed in white (and black too).

The ladies of the Lansdale Historical Society board and its membership pool held the second annual Spring Tea at Elm Terrace Gardens on Saturday with the theme "An Affiar to Remember."

Female family members of the ladies of the society sashayed in through the Dorothy Stiteler Dining Room in wedding gowns from the 1920s through the 2000s.

Colleen Peterson, of Harleysville Bridal, emceed the fashion show.

The event also featured photos of notable Lansdale residents present and past on their wedding days. There were also wedding tradition artifacts donated by various members. The Mennonite Heritage Center in Franconia provided a dress from the 1880s that was for display only.
